Selectivity
Is Columbia hard to get into?
Columbia Law School is among the more selective law schools in the country. 11.8% of the 9,463 applicants in the 2025 First Year Class were offered admission. The middle 50% of admitted students scored between 169 and 175 on the LSAT, with GPAs between 3.85 and 3.98.
